CardiaTec, a TechBio company employing computational methods to decode the biology behind cardiovascular disease, has raised $6.5M in seed funding led by San Francisco-based Montage Ventures.
Cambridge-based CardiaTec has raised $6.5mn for its AI-based drug discovery platform for cardiovascular diseases.
